The telephone rang. A very embarrassed voice explained that he
heard that someone he knows met a friend that has a neighbour
who knows a photographer… all in one trait and rather fast.

The man has just got the licence, the diploma and the uniform to
be a full member the National Rescue Diving Squad. He would like
a portrait for his parents and family, and for the official website of
the organisation.

He never was in a photographer's studio and he was quite shy. I
managed this portrait of a newly uniformed gentleman…
